资讯专栏INFORMATION COLUMN

GridManager 隐藏列

cppowboy / 1031人阅读

摘要:表格管理组件,对列的隐藏与显示的操作有两种方式。初始化时指定列为隐藏或显示状态。在已经执行过的前提下,可通过如下方式对列进行操作对第一列进行显示对第二列进行隐藏批量操作隐藏第二和第三列批量操作显示全部列

GridManager 表格管理组件, 对列的隐藏与显示的操作有两种方式。
初始化时指定列为隐藏或显示状态。方式如下:
var table = document.querySelector("table");
table.GM({
    gridManagerName: "test",
    ajax_url: "http://www.lovejavascript.com/learnLinkManager/getLearnLinkList",
    columnData: [{
        key: "name",
        // 指定不显示该列
        isShow: false,
        text: "username"
    },{
        key: "type",
        // 指定显示该列
        isShow: true,
        text: "type"
    },{
        key: "info",
        // 不指定该列的显示状态, 默认为true
        text: "info"
    }]
});
渲染完成后,对列进行隐藏或显示操作。在已经执行过init的前提下,可通过如下方式对列进行操作:
// 对第一列进行显示
var table = document.querySelector("table");
var th_name = table.querySelector("th[th-name="name"]");
table.GM("showTh", th_name);
// 对第二列进行隐藏
var table = document.querySelector("table");
var th_type = table.querySelector("th[th-name="type"]");
table.GM("hideTh", th_type);
// 批量操作 -> 隐藏第二和第三列
var table = document.querySelector("table");
var thList = table.querySelectorAll("th");
document.querySelector("table").GM("hideTh", [thList[1], thList[2]]); 
// 批量操作 -> 显示全部列
var table = document.querySelector("table");
var thList = table.querySelectorAll("th");
document.querySelector("table").GM("showTh", thList); 

文章版权归作者所有,未经允许请勿转载,若此文章存在违规行为,您可以联系管理员删除。

转载请注明本文地址:https://www.ucloud.cn/yun/52314.html

相关文章

  • GridManager 隐藏

    摘要:表格管理组件,对列的隐藏与显示的操作有两种方式。初始化时指定列为隐藏或显示状态。在已经执行过的前提下,可通过如下方式对列进行操作对第一列进行显示对第二列进行隐藏批量操作隐藏第二和第三列批量操作显示全部列 GridManager 表格管理组件, 对列的隐藏与显示的操作有两种方式。 初始化时指定列为隐藏或显示状态。方式如下: var table = document.querySele...

    luqiuwen 评论0 收藏0
  • GridManager 隐藏

    摘要:表格管理组件,对列的隐藏与显示的操作有两种方式。初始化时指定列为隐藏或显示状态。在已经执行过的前提下,可通过如下方式对列进行操作对第一列进行显示对第二列进行隐藏批量操作隐藏第二和第三列批量操作显示全部列 GridManager 表格管理组件, 对列的隐藏与显示的操作有两种方式。 初始化时指定列为隐藏或显示状态。方式如下: var table = document.querySele...

    roland_reed 评论0 收藏0
  • GridManager 用户偏好记忆

    摘要:启用用户偏好记忆禁用该功能将导致用户所调整的宽度列位置列的显示隐藏状态及每页显示条数不再拥有记忆效果。触发清除方法手动清除用户偏好记忆清除后,再次刷新时原先的用户记忆将失效。 GridManager 会将用户的部分操作进行记忆,从而达到用户行为记忆的效果。 为什么在GridManager中会存在用户偏好记忆 在数据的时代,一份数据往往会由不同的角色共享。而这些角色所关注的数据项并不相同...

    alin 评论0 收藏0
  • React 表格组件 GridManager-React

    摘要:基于的封装用于便捷的在中使用除过特性外,其它与相同。刷新更新查询条件其它更多请直接访问查看当前版本的版本的版本 GridManager React 基于 React 的 GridManager 封装, 用于便捷的在 React 中使用GridManager. 除过React特性外,其它API与GridManager API相同。 showImg(https://segmentfault...

    cyixlq 评论0 收藏0
  • Vue表格组件--GridManager Vue

    摘要:基于的封装用于便捷的在中使用除过特性外,其它与相同。非必设项筛选条件列表数组对象。格式在使用时该参数为必设项。并且使用服务需要提前通过将注册至全局组件。刷新或更新查询条件或其它更多请直接访问查看当前版本 GridManager Vue 基于 Vue 的 GridManager 封装, 用于便捷的在 Vue 中使用GridManager. 除过Vue特性外,其它API与GridManag...

    khs1994 评论0 收藏0

发表评论

0条评论

最新活动
阅读需要支付1元查看
<